2006 Canada $1 Fine Gold Proof Coin - Gold Louis
During the 17th and 18th century, the inhabitants of New France faced chronic shortages. Their colony was months away from the motherland, isolated by the Atlantic Ocean whose treacherous waters claimed countless sailing ships. Everything was scarce - including coins.

An entire annual budget of coins was lost when Le Chameau slammed into the coast of Cape Breton in 1725, leaving no survivors and bits of the broken cargo washed ashore.

And, in 1965, hundreds of gold coins in near perfect condition were found!

99.99% pure gold
14.10 mm
1.581 g
Mintage 5648
